发明名称 |
System and method for paging flow entries in a flow-based switching device |
摘要 |
A network switching device includes a macroflow sub-plane that performs packet-based routing in the network switching device and a microflow routing sub-plane that performs flow-based routing in the network switching device. The microflow routing sub-plane receives a first data packet, determines that the first data packet is associated with a first flow page, wherein the first flow page comprises a plurality of flow entries, determines that the first flow page is not resident in a routing table of the microflow routing sub-plane, and requests the first flow page from a software defined network (SDN) controller. |
申请公布号 |
US9641428(B2) |
申请公布日期 |
2017.05.02 |
申请号 |
US201313850004 |
申请日期 |
2013.03.25 |
申请人 |
Dell Products, LP |
发明人 |
Narayanan Rajesh;Kotha Saikrishna M. |
分类号 |
H04L12/26;H04L12/721;H04L12/933;H04L12/947;H04L12/931 |
主分类号 |
H04L12/26 |
代理机构 |
Larson Newman, LLP |
代理人 |
Larson Newman, LLP |
主权项 |
1. A network switching device comprising:
a macroflow sub-plane that performs packet-based routing in the network switching device based upon an identity of a first port that receives data packets and an identity of a second port to which the data packet are to be forwarded, as determined by a header of the data packets, the macroflow sub-plane configured to:
receive a first data packet; anddetermine that the first data packet is not to be routed based upon the packet-based routing; and a microflow routing sub-plane that performs flow-based routing in the network switching device based upon a flow identity associated with the data packets, the microflow routing sub-plane configured to:
receive the first data packet from the macroflow sub-plane;determine that the first data packet is associated with an unknown flow entry;send the first data packet to a software defined network (SDN) controller in response to determining that the first data packet is associated with the unknown flow entry; andreceive, from the SUN controller, a first flow page including a first plurality of flow entries in response to sending the first data packet. |
地址 |
Round Rock TX US |